I have a Question also!
The SV_PURE is checking materials in memory or hard dive ?????

Lisa
17th December 2007, 13:35
Uhm, the materials in the materials directory on your hard drive, if you use any custom materials at all.

Lisa
17th December 2007, 23:36
Don't worry, your English is fine. (Your comment on that is pretty weird anyways.)


Every time you connect to a server, your client will see what the server's pure mode value is and then load the default materials from the game content files if necessary.
